1 CORPS TROOPS LEARN USE OF THE MILITARY IN LAW ENFORCEMENT DURING TRAINING DAY PROGRAMME

Under the guidance of the, Directorate of Human Rights and International Humanitarian Law, a valuable and timely needed lecture on “Use of the Military in Law Enforcement”, was held with the participation of Officers and other ranks of 1 Corps and its affiliated Logistics Units, at the headquarters 1 Corps on 07 September 2022.

The lecture was conducted by the Lt Col IMSSK Ilankoon RWP RSP psc, Commanding Officer of 9 Gemunu Watch and Maj KAPA Rathnayaka . During the programme, the participants were educated on Human Rights and Law Enforcement Powers, Basic principles, Arrest/ Detention and Search/Seizure, etc. Training audience was consisting with 272 Officers and Other Ranks of HQ 1 Corps and affiliated logistic units tps.
